What Is Emo Wallpaper?

Emo wallpaper refers to a specific aesthetic style of digital or physical backgrounds that align with the emo subculture. This style is characterized by its use of dark and moody colors, emotional themes, and symbolic imagery. Emo wallpapers often feature elements such as broken hearts, lonely figures, abstract patterns, and lyrics or quotes from emo music. They serve as a visual extension of the emo lifestyle, offering a way for individuals to express their emotions through art and design.

The Origins of Emo Wallpaper

The concept of emo wallpaper traces its roots back to the early 2000s, coinciding with the rise of emo music and culture. As emo bands like My Chemical Romance and Dashboard Confessional gained popularity, fans sought ways to visually represent their emotional connection to the music. Emo wallpapers became a medium for this expression, blending artistic elements with the themes and aesthetics of emo culture.

Common themes in emo wallpaper include heartbreak, solitude, rebellion, and self-expression. Many designs feature dark and muted color palettes, such as black, gray, and deep red, often contrasted with splashes of bright colors like pink or neon green. Iconic imagery, such as broken hearts, skulls, roses, and abstract patterns, is frequently used to convey emotion and artistry.

In recent years, emo wallpaper has evolved to incorporate modern design trends. Neon aesthetics, glitch art, and digital collages have become popular, blending traditional emo themes with contemporary styles. The rise of social media platforms like Instagram and Pinterest has also influenced emo wallpaper trends, with artists and creators sharing their work with a global audience.
